Abstract
The invention discloses the LCD liquid crystal display die sets that display is kept after a kind of power down; including LCD display, LED backlight and power down protection drive circuit board; the LED backlight is placed in LCD display medial surface; power down protection drive circuit board is installed on the lower end surface of LED backlight and LCD display; the power down protection drive circuit board is connect with the pin that LED backlight is led to, and is weldingly connected between the power down protection drive circuit board and LCD display by the metal pin on LCD and is formed a complete LCD liquid crystal display die set.Liquid crystal display die set of the present invention can keep display current picture data after system power supply power down, realize the effect that data storage protection is shown after power down, it is therefore prevented that show the function of loss of data.It is widely used in the instrument and meter for having uninterrupted display to require.

Referring to Fig. 1, embodiment 1: in the embodiment of the present invention, the LCD liquid crystal display die set of display is kept after a kind of power down,
Including LCD display 1, LED backlight 2 and power down protection drive circuit board 3, the LED backlight 2 is placed in LCD display 1
Medial surface, power down protection drive circuit board 3 are installed on the lower end surface of LED backlight 2 and LCD display 1, and the power down protection drives
Dynamic circuit board 3 is connect with LED backlight 2 by pin, is passed through between the power down protection drive circuit board 3 and LCD display 1
Metal pin on LCD, which is weldingly connected, forms a complete LCD liquid crystal display die set.Power down protection drive circuit board is the hair
It include a DAT signal adapter, CLK level translator, FRM signal on power down protection drive circuit board where bright core
Converter, COM signal generator and the power down protection modular circuit being made of farad capacitor.The COM generator is provided with
One to six pin, the DAT signal adapter are provided with the 8th pin, and the CLK level translator is provided with the 7th pin,
FRM signal adapter is provided with the 9th pin, forms COM signal generator and ALT signal by chip U1, chip U2, chip U3
Generator.System electrification, C1 farad capacitor store charge, by inside chip U1 power on level by internal logic reverse phase it is defeated
Out, through resistance R1 the first and second pin of loop input, thus generate circulation output concussion, output again through chip U2 third and fourth
Pin input inversion shaping generates rectangular wave and does ALT signal.ALT signal inputs the five, the six pins of chip U3, by chip U3
Logical inversion generates the COM signal opposite and synchronous with ALT signal.After system is powered down, C1 farad capacitor discharges charge to chip
U1, chip U2, chip U3, COM signal generator maintain exporting for COM signal to drive display picture to LCD.Power down protection mould
CLK, DAT, FRM signal that block circuit board is provided using MCU chip input to level translator chip U4, chip U5, core respectively
Piece U6 provides the storage of display data signal after power down for LCD driving circuit.
